我有一个从我的导师那里得到的基本程序集。基本上有两个部分: 1. 有一个库程序,学生应该先编译它。 2. 有几个示例程序需要使用库程序的“支持”。
此处显示了属性(property)经理的屏幕截图:
我认为 Microsoft.Cpp.Win32.user 属性表可用于全局设置;
osgVirtualEnvironment 是库程序的名称。但似乎没有由 example1 解决方案命名的正确表?(因为我认为应该有一个用于本地包含和库设置的属性表)
另外,还有两个被库程序命名的属性表:osgVirtualEnvironment APP, osg虚拟环境库。看来我需要为两个属性表设置用户宏才能执行 #include<>
我的问题是:
1.为什么有两个以库程序命名的属性表,而没有以示例程序命名的属性表?
2.osgVirtualEnvironment Library的User Macro(一个属性表),名称为OSGVE_DIR,Value为:$(SolutionDir)\..\..\..\.. SolutionDir的路径是指osgVirtualEnvironment.sln 还是osgVirtualEnvironment 库Debug.props 的路径?
最佳答案
如果您的问题是“为什么我的项目没有属性表”,那么答案是:
没必要。属性表使您可以在多个项目中重复使用属性。如果您只想编辑项目的属性,可以从主菜单“项目 -> 属性”进行。
至于为什么那个库有两个属性表,我就不知道了。问问你的老师,他是为你设置的,对吧?
关于c++ - 查询vs2010的属性表,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14638735/